CDC says pregnant women can travel to Zika areas if they stay above 6,500 feet
![]() ![]() ![]() U.S. health officials have come up with an exception to their travel warnings for the Zika virus: altitude.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) says that the mosquito that spreads the Zika virus is rare above 6,500 feet (2,000 meters). Therefore,*it is OK for pregnant women to travel to*destinations at high elevations like*Mexico City. But the updates will **t make a big difference in most affected countries. SEE ALSO: Zika virus presents female Olympic athletes with awful dilemma The CDC has advised pregnant women to avoid travel to a total of 37 countries and territories because the Zika virus is the suspected cause of a surge of birth defects in Brazil.
